No traffic road cycling routes around Avricourt traverse a landscape characterized by tranquil waterways, extensive forests, and rolling countryside in the Grand Est region of France. The area features well-paved surfaces ideal for road cycling, particularly along the Canal de la Marne au Rhin. Cyclists can explore routes that pass by the Etang de Gondrexange and incorporate gentle elevations. This diverse terrain offers varied experiences for road cyclists.

The imposing neoclassical-style town hall was built to the plans of the architect Antoine-Alexandre Jandel at the end of the Restoration (1830).

On a limestone spur above the Vezouze lies the Château de Blâmont, built around 1200. Once the seat of the Counts of Blâmont, later a romantic castle and even a weaving mill. In 1944 it was badly damaged by American bombing. Today the ruins – with five towers – are a silent witness to centuries of history.

This impressive canal bridge crosses the Saar River between the villages of Hesse and Xouaxange, in Moselle. Built of metal, it is a testament to 19th-century civil engineering and is part of the region's river heritage. It is a peaceful place, steeped in history, offering magnificent views of the valley and surrounding landscapes. 🚶♂️ Accessible on foot or by bike via the towpath, it makes an ideal stopover during a stroll along the canal. The routes around Avricourt feature mostly well-paved surfaces, ideal for road cycling. You'll encounter gentle elevations and rolling countryside, making for enjoyable rides without extreme climbs. The area is characterized by diverse landscapes of waterways, forests, and open fields.
Yes, Avricourt offers several easy, traffic-free road cycling routes. For instance, the Kerprich-aux-Bois lock – Grand Pond of Mittersheim loop from Gondrexange is an easy option, covering about 45 km with minimal elevation gain. Many routes along the Canal de la Marne au Rhin are also generally flat and suitable for a relaxed pace.
You'll find beautiful natural features and interesting landmarks. Many routes follow the scenic Canal de la Marne au Rhin Cycle Path, passing by tranquil waterways and the large Etang de Gondrexange. A notable landmark is The Great Lock of Réchicourt, an impressive 16-meter high lock, often incorporated into routes like the Crossing the small pond – The Great Lock of Réchicourt loop from Xousse.
Yes, many of the no traffic road cycling routes around Avricourt are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point. Examples include the Amenoncourt loop from Autrepierre and the Kerprich-aux-Bois lock – Grand Pond of Mittersheim loop from Gondrexange.
The region is generally pleasant for cycling from spring through autumn. The weather is typically mild, and the natural landscapes, including the waterways and forests, are at their most vibrant. While winter cycling is possible, some facilities or services along the routes might be limited.

Yes, for more experienced riders seeking a longer challenge, routes like the Resistance Memorial – Maison Mazerand loop from Igney - Avricourt offer a moderate difficulty level, covering over 77 km with significant elevation gain. Another option is the Parroy Church – Marne–Rhine Canal loop from Igney, which is over 66 km long and also moderately challenging.
